EscherAtom.java 源代码
package jxl.biff.drawing;
import common.Logger;
class EscherAtom extends EscherRecord {
static Class class$jxl$biff$drawing$EscherAtom;
private static Logger logger;
static {
Class cls = class$jxl$biff$drawing$EscherAtom;
if (cls == null) {
cls = class$("jxl.biff.drawing.EscherAtom");
class$jxl$biff$drawing$EscherAtom = cls;
}
logger = Logger.getLogger(cls);
}
static Class class$(String str) {
try {
return Class.forName(str);
} catch (ClassNotFoundException e) {
throw new NoClassDefFoundError(e.getMessage());
}
}
public EscherAtom(EscherRecordData escherRecordData) {
super(escherRecordData);
}
public EscherAtom(EscherRecordType escherRecordType) {
super(escherRecordType);
}
@Override
public byte[] getData() {
Logger logger2 = logger;
StringBuffer stringBuffer = new StringBuffer();
stringBuffer.append("escher atom getData called on object of type ");
stringBuffer.append(getClass().getName());
stringBuffer.append(" code ");
stringBuffer.append(Integer.toString(getType().getValue(), 16));
logger2.warn(stringBuffer.toString());
return null;
}
}